Both are for 1pc rms, so I believe either would be correct. TPI cars got the lighter flywheel and the TBI cars got heavier piece. Performance wise I would think one would prefer the lighter flywheel. I have a flywheel from an 2wd 87 Chevy truck that came with a 1pc rms sbc and a 4 speed. I will dig it out tomorrow and see if/how it’s different.
i changed to the lighter flywheel on a clutch swap when i was running a cammed 305 and i did not like it.. no momentum on take off. went back to the heavy one

Re: T-5 swap gone bad
****UPDATE**** so the vibration problem has been solved.... It was a simple fix. The one piece RMS 5.0 takes a NEUTRAL balanced flywheel... Dont care if the flex plate has the butterfly weight on it... Finally had the chance to swap out the standard balanced for the neutral balanced and reused all the hardware and NO balance... Im thinking the information on this subject should be updated so others dont run into this issue. Thanks to everyone that offered advice on the subject it was much appreciated.
